The Lagos State Government has reacted to a viral video where pupils were seen in a flooded school assembly ground, WonderTV Media reports.

In the video, the pupils of primary school age were seen singing the national anthem, knee-deep in murky floodwaters.

However, in reaction to the video, the Lagos State Ministry of Education on its Facebook page stated that the building has been demolished and being built.
